Reconnaissance des modèles de marques OMR en .NET

Catégorie du blog: Traitement des formulaires.NET

21.05.2025

Pour créer un modèle de formulaire, vous devez numériser une image d'un formulaire vierge et définir des modèles de champs sur l'image numérisée. Un formulaire contient souvent des marques OMR distinctes ou des tableaux de marques OMR.

Pour définir le modèle de marque OMR, sélectionnez la zone de marque OMR sur l'image du modèle de formulaire à l'aide de la souris. Pour définir le modèle de tableau de marques OMR, sélectionnez la zone de tableau sur l'image du modèle de formulaire à l'aide de la souris et spécifiez les distances entre les cellules du tableau.

S'il y a de nombreuses marques OMR, vous devez utiliser la souris pour sélectionner plusieurs zones sur l'image du modèle, ce qui prend beaucoup de temps.

Conscients de ce problème, nous avons ajouté une fonctionnalité au VintaSoft Forms Processing .NET Plug-in permettant la recherche et la création automatiques de modèles de marques OMR dans la zone du modèle de formulaire, ce qui a considérablement simplifié le processus.
Désormais, l'outil visuel Vintasoft.Imaging.FormsProcessing.FormRecognition.UI.VisualTools.FormFieldTemplateEditorTool recherche les marques OMR dans la zone sélectionnée sur l'image du modèle de formulaire si la propriété FormFieldTemplateEditorTool.IsFieldTemplateAutomaticBuildingEnabled est définie sur True.Vous pouvez rapidement évaluer les fonctionnalités créées grâce à l'application de démonstration "VintaSoft Forms Processing Demo".

Pour détecter automatiquement une marque OMR rectangulaire/elliptique sur une image modèle dans l'application "VintaSoft Forms Processing Demo", procédez comme suit:

Pour détecter automatiquement un tableau composé de marques OMR rectangulaires/elliptiques sur une image modèle dans l'application de démonstration "VintaSoft Forms Processing Demo", procédez comme suit: